Studio portrait of Second Lieutenant (2nd Lt) Francis James Burton, 4th Light Horse Regiment. A farmer from Nullan (near Minyip), Victoria, prior to enlistment as a Private (Pte) on 22 August 1914, he embarked from Melbourne aboard HMAT Wiltshire on 19 October 1914 for Egypt. He served in Gallipoli and following the withdrawal from the Dardanelles he continued to serve in the Egypt and Palestine theatre rising through the ranks to become Sergeant (Sgt) on 30 May 1916 and Squadron Sergeant Major on 15 March 1917. Sgt Burton was commissioned as a 2nd Lt on 20 September 1917. 2nd Lt Burton was killed in action near Beersheba, Palestine, on 31 October 1917. He was aged 24 years.
